It is bad. Do you know what a strand of hair looks like? It's not one smooth layer, it's a bunch of cells that look much like roof shingles. They're laid one on top of each other. If you rub your hair, you push these hair "shingles up, causing static, kinks, weakened follicles, etc. Deep conditioners help, but constant rubbing of your hair after your shower, a time when your hair follicles are the most delicate, leads to damage over time.
